2013 Channel One Cup corporate image is designed

09.10.2013

Designing corporate image of the Russian round of Euro Hockey Tour- - Channel One Cup that will be held 19-22 October in Sochi - is finished.

 

Snowman which is the main graphic element of the image hasn’t changed, but found new form, style that depicts idea of long-time heritage of Russian hockey and continuity of generations. It’s the first time corporate image has been performed in 3D format.

 

Head of the Marketing and Communications Department Elena Abubakirova: "Over the time of 46 years snowman has been our tournament invariable symbol. By designing new image of the Channel One Cup main character we pay tribute to "Izvestiya Price Cup”. We want to demonstrate importance of expressing our respect towards traditions, adapting them to nowadays reality. Hope that this character starts its own life!"
